A dog-minder had his ear ripped off via an XL bully after it attacked him whilst he slept.
Darren Shuttleworth-Long, 52, from Swindon was once drowsing peacefully subsequent to the banned breed on his settee on April 26, however was once woken up after it began biting him.
The canine sitter was once taking good care of the hound for anyone else and described the animal crashing in to him a number of instances and snapping and snarling ahead of biting his face.
He will now require cosmetic surgery to reconstruct his ear and confessed he struggles to go away the home or even listening to a canine bark sends shivers down his backbone.

Wiltshire police showed a 24-year-old girl was once arrested on suspicion of being in command of a canine dangerously out of keep watch over inflicting damage.
She has been launched on bail pending additional enquiries.
Since February 1, 2024, proudly owning the XL Bully breed has develop into a legal offence in England and Wales until homeowners have an exemption certificates and any individual who owns some of the canine must have the animal neutered and microchipped.
